Model 8990: When the shaver is fully charged, all five 
charging lights (16) will light up (20% per light), provided 
the shaver is plugged in or switched on. 
 
Model 8986: When the shaver is fully charged, all three 
charging lights (16) will light up, provided the shaver is 
plugged in or switched on.
Model 8985: The green single charging light (16) shows 
that the shaver is being charged. When fully charged, the 
charging light flashes or turns off. If later on, the charging 
light turns on again, this indicates that the shaver is being 
recharged to maintain its full capacity. 
Charging information
A full charge will give up to 50 minutes of cordless shaving 
time, depending on your beard growth.
Best environmental temperature range for charging is 
60°F to 75°F/15 °C to 35 °C.
For battery maintenance, the system will automatically 
initiate full discharging and then recharging of the 
batteries. This will take place every six months at the 
most, and only if necessary.
Replacement light for shaving parts/Reset
To maintain 100% shaving performance, replace your foil 
and cutter block, when the replacement light for shaving 
parts (18) comes on (after about 18 months) or when worn. 
Change both parts at the same time for a closer shave with 
less skin irritation.
(Shaver foil (10) and cutter block (11): 8000 series)
The replacement light will remind you during the next 
7 shaves to replace the shaving parts. Then the shaver 
will automatically reset the display.
After you have replaced the shaving parts (foil and cutter 
block), use a ball-pen to push the «reset» button (19) for at 
least 3 seconds to reset the counter.
While doing so, the replacement light blinks and goes off 
when the reset is complete. The manual reset can be done 
at any time.
